Senior Software Engineer
Backend
Confirmed live in the last 24 hours
Vannevar Labs

51-200 employees

National security & defense software
Company Overview
Vannevar Labs stands out as a leading company in the defense sector, specializing in creating solutions for the digital age, which gives it a competitive edge in the rapidly evolving tech industry. The company's culture fosters technical creativity and problem-solving, enabling it to consistently develop advanced defense technologies. As recognized by the Financial Times, Vannevar Labs' industry leadership is evident in its ability to adapt and respond to the dynamic digital landscape.
AI & Machine Learning
Aerospace
B2B

Company Stage

Series B

Total Funding

$87M

Founded

2019

Headquarters

Palo Alto, California

Growth & Insights
Headcount

6 month growth

20%

1 year growth

115%

2 year growth

313%
Locations
Remote
Experience Level
Entry
Junior
Mid
Senior
Expert
Desired Skills
AWS
Data Analysis
Elasticsearch
Postgres
Python
CategoriesNew
Software Engineering
Requirements
  • 4+ years of professional software development experience as a backend engineer - you have worked on systems that are deployed in production environments
  • A proven ability to work across teams to coordinate and solve engineering problems
  • Strong experience with either NodeJS or Python
  • Excellent communication and teamwork skills
  • U.S. Person status is required with the ability to obtain security clearance
Responsibilities
  • Build a data platform that supports heterogenous datasets - ranging from 200TB of geospatial data, text and multimedia in over 46 different languages, and other mission related datasets
  • Solve large-scale data synchronization problems, including propagating data between multiple data stores and external systems
  • Architect and build an authorization service to allow granular permissioning on our data assets
  • Develop sampling strategies to filter massive geospatial data to enable rendering on an end-user's web browser
Desired Qualifications
  • Experience optimizing queries and indices with Postgres
  • Experience performance tuning ElasticSearch clusters and queries
  • Experience with other parts of our stack, including OpenSearch, Temporal, NodeJS, and Python - which are all managed by IaaC on AWS
  • Experience leveraging distributed data processing to establish robust data pipelines capable of supporting hyperbolic scale